6 implementations of IZipIOBlock
WindowsBase (6)
Base\MS\Internal\IO\Zip\ZipIOCentralDirectoryBlock.cs (1)
37internal class ZipIOCentralDirectoryBlock : IZipIOBlock
Base\MS\Internal\IO\Zip\ZipIOEndOfCentralDirectoryBlock.cs (1)
35internal class ZipIOEndOfCentralDirectoryBlock : IZipIOBlock
Base\MS\Internal\IO\Zip\ZipIOLocalFileBlock.cs (1)
40internal class ZipIOLocalFileBlock : IZipIOBlock, IDisposable
Base\MS\Internal\IO\Zip\ZipIORawDataFileBlock.cs (1)
35internal class ZipIORawDataFileBlock : IZipIOBlock
Base\MS\Internal\IO\Zip\ZipIOZip64EndOfCentralDirectoryBlock.cs (1)
34internal class ZipIOZip64EndOfCentralDirectoryBlock : IZipIOBlock
Base\MS\Internal\IO\Zip\ZipIOZip64EndOfCentralDirectoryLocatorBlock.cs (1)
34internal class ZipIOZip64EndOfCentralDirectoryLocatorBlock : IZipIOBlock
13 references to IZipIOBlock
WindowsBase (13)
Base\MS\Internal\IO\Zip\ZipIOBlockManager.cs (10)
774foreach (IZipIOBlock block in _blockList) 893foreach (IZipIOBlock currentBlock in _blockList) 913IZipIOBlock currentBlock = (IZipIOBlock)_blockList[i]; 934if (((IZipIOBlock)_blockList[j]).PreSaveNotification(currentBlockOffset, currentBlockSize) == 979IZipIOBlock currentBlock = (IZipIOBlock)_blockList[i]; 1167private void MapBlock(IZipIOBlock block) 1211private void InsertBlock(int blockPosition, IZipIOBlock block) 1220private void AppendBlock(IZipIOBlock block)
Base\MS\Internal\IO\Zip\ZipIOCentralDirectoryBlock.cs (1)
186foreach(IZipIOBlock block in _blockManager)
Base\MS\Internal\IO\Zip\ZipIORawDataFileBlock.cs (2)
179internal bool DiskImageContains(IZipIOBlock block) 202internal void SplitIntoPrefixSuffix(IZipIOBlock block,